Highland Oaks is consistently praised by families for its compassionate, respectful staff and exceptionally clean environment. Reviewers frequently highlight a home-like atmosphere where residents are treated with dignity and genuine care, making it a highly regarded option for long-term and skilled nursing needs.

Highland Oaks has 15 deficiencies across four surveys, with families filing complaints that led to findings about resident protection from financial exploitation and medication services. The facility shows recurring issues with fire safety systems, electrical systems, and infection control across multiple years, though all violations have been corrected by the provider.
